    Coast Guard Petty Officer 2nd Class Luke Housand, operates a 27-foot Special Purpose Craft-Shallow Water from Station Yankeetown, Florida, in search for three people aboard a missing aircraft seven miles south of Cedar Key, Florida, Monday, Feb. 13, 2017. Coast Guard crews alongside partner agencies began searching for the people after a plane failed to arrive in Cedar Key en route from Brooksville, Florida. (U.S. Coast Guard photo by Petty Officer 3rd Class Kyle Tappan)
